'SAY NO TO DRUGS, SAY YES TO LIFE' RALLY


The Drug Awareness Club of Government Serchhip College organized a rally under the theme “Say No to Drugs, Say Yes to Life” on 12th February 2026, from New Serchhip Venglai to the College Campus. The programme was sponsored by Nasha Mukti Bharat Abhiyan (NMBA) and witnessed active participation from college students, members of the Drug Awareness Club, and teachers in charge.

Nasha Mukti Bharat Abhiyan, launched on 15th August 2020, is a nationwide initiative aimed at combating drug abuse across the country. The campaign focuses on creating awareness about the harmful effects of drugs in educational institutions, communities, and households, with the objective of promoting a drug-free India.

The rally served as an important initiative in raising awareness about the dangers of substance abuse among students and the general public, reinforcing the commitment of the institution towards building a healthy and drug-free society.
